Output ef2e49d5e033b2d0bbfd123472c55e1735699fa550bcef593f030fc24fee600a:4

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 ac42a2c57509433b5d4cea5f9169812bddf2f337
address
bc1q43p293t4p9pnkh2vaf0ez6vp90wl9ueh09mg0a
transaction
ef2e49d5e033b2d0bbfd123472c55e1735699fa550bcef593f030fc24fee600a
confirmations
149952
spent
true